Key Responsibilities:

The Project Coordinator supports the AA design, coordination, and implementation of anticipatory interventions to reduce disaster risks and strengthen community resilience in Kabuntalan, Pagalungan, Maguindanao, and Liguasan. The role ensures timely execution of activities through stakeholder collaboration, logistics management, progress monitoring, and documentation. It aligns anticipatory actions with early warning systems, preparedness plans, and organizational strategies for proactive crisis response. M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Support the planning and execution of anticipatory action activities in coordination with early warning systems and preparedness protocols.
  • Collaborate with internal teams and external partners to ensure timely delivery of project milestones and outputs.
  • Facilitate operational alignment across stakeholders to enable proactive and efficient implementation of anticipatory interventions.
  • Facilitate ongoing communication and collaboration among government agencies, humanitarian actors, community representatives, and technical experts to ensure cohesive and inclusive project implementation.
  • Organize and actively participate in coordination meetings, workshops, and consultations to promote stakeholder alignment, secure buy-in, and strengthen multi-sectoral engagement in anticipatory action planning.
  • Assist in organizing and facilitating training sessions, simulations, and learning events to enhance the capacity of local stakeholders in implementing anticipatory action effectively.
  • Contribute to the documentation and dissemination of lessons learned, case studies, and best practices to inform future programming and promote continuous improvement.
  • Coordinate procurement processes and logistical arrangements to ensure the timely and efficient delivery of anticipatory interventions/project activities.
  • Ensure full compliance with organizational policies and donor requirements during procurement and implementation, maintaining transparency, accountability, and operational integrity.
  • Track project progress against indicators and timelines, ensuring accurate documentation of activities, outputs, and results.
  • Collect and consolidate data for monitoring project progress and impact.
  • Prepare timely reports for internal and external stakeholders, including donors.
  • Support learning and documentation of best practices for anticipatory action in conflict settings.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Minimum of 3 years of relevant experience in project coordination, preferably in humanitarian, disaster risk reduction, or climate resilience programs.
  • Demonstrated experience in implementing anticipatory action, early warning systems, or forecast-based financing initiatives.
  • Proven ability to coordinate multi-stakeholder projects involving government agencies, NGOs, technical experts, and community groups.
  • Experience in organizing trainings, simulations, and learning events focused on preparedness and risk reduction.
  • Experience in procurement and logistics management, with knowledge of donor compliance and operational standards.
  • Familiarity with risk data, vulnerability assessments, and the use of forecasts to inform programmatic decisions.
  •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field such as Disaster Risk Reduction, Development Studies, Social Sciences, Environmental Science, Public Administration, or a related discipline.
